31 WEDNESDAY - MAY 1972
152ND DAY - 214 DAYS TO COME


Downtown to Jerry D'Arcey's room in Statler Hilton Hotel. He
showed me the games he is presenting to the manufacturers,
most of which are not his own.
STOREKEEPER - party game. Each player is given a card with
a type of store and a list of items sold in that store. They
then turn it over after looking at it. They are then dealt
cards with different objects on them, which are kept face
down in a pile. They are faced one at a time. When two of
the same object show each player calls out an object sold in
his store. First wins the cards in the other's face-up
pile (I believe). Can't repeat the same object during game.
SCOOPERS AND SNOOPERS - a board game about reporters getting
scoops and bringing them back to their paper. Played
with dice but didn't get the details. By Hans Goldschmidt,
and didn't look very interesting.
